Transaction c31d5ec9a2b4a349e3a4d7ce8fe789e7e2862c43bd8fc4ff62b3d441bfaa179a

25 Input
2 Outputs
  • c31d5ec9a2b4a349e3a4d7ce8fe789e7e2862c43bd8fc4ff62b3d441bfaa179a:0
  • value  50050000
    address  3MGGwyvkuCcxyFVkaQchCQZCfMo6gwZd9D
  • c31d5ec9a2b4a349e3a4d7ce8fe789e7e2862c43bd8fc4ff62b3d441bfaa179a:1
  • value  760354
    address  18QiBqoDbn6so3kSBe8sWgj7zo7qBath6S